Sgt. Snoddy Awarded Combat Infantryman Badge
12th Armored Division, 7th Army, France
Scottsville News, 22 February 1945 (p.1):
Sgt. James H. Snoddy, 33133404, husband of Mrs. Louise B. Snoddy of Rt. 3, Scottsville, has been awarded the Combat Infantryman Badge.
This badge is awarded for satisfactory performance of duty in ground combat against the enemy and entitles the soldier to $10 per mont
additional pay. The badge is worn on the left breast above the service ribbons.
The local soldier is a member of the 12th Armored Division, commanded by Maj. General Roderick R. Allen, and has been overseas three
months. His unit is one of the newest on the front of Lt. Gen. Alexander M. Patch's 7th Army.
